Waller County Jail Custody Role

Waller County Jail is one of the outside county jails listed by Trinity County for off-site inmate contact. This is not a minor detail in Trinity County. TCJS data and Trinity's own current-inmates page show that the Trinity County inmate population can be split between the small local jail and several other Texas county jails. A person with a Trinity County case may be physically housed in Waller County Jail even though the court file remains in Trinity County.

Use Waller County Jail for the questions tied to the bed: current custody, local visit rules, housing status, mail address, inmate phone options, and approved money deposit process. Use Trinity County for the questions tied to the case: charge filing, bond, court dates, prosecutor action, and older Trinity booking records. Mixing those two tracks can lead to wrong vendor payments or a missed court-related deadline.

Waller County Jail is a county jail, not a state prison or federal detention center. County jail custody usually covers pretrial inmates, local sentences, holds, and contract beds. Sentenced state prison custody should be checked through TDCJ after transfer.

Waller County Jail Inmate Search

The first search step for a Trinity County case is still the Trinity County current-inmates page. That page is the official local source that lists off-site jail contacts, including Waller County Jail. The page has search, sort, and location controls, but research found a temporary data-disruption notice during inspection. When the online feed does not give a clear answer, use the phone numbers.

  1. Search Trinity County's current-inmates page by the person's name or other known booking detail.
  2. Check for an off-site location or contact that names Waller County Jail.
  3. Call Waller County Jail to verify that the person is physically housed there.
  4. Ask Waller which visit, phone, mail, and commissary vendor rules apply.
  5. Contact Trinity County for Trinity bond, court date, charge, and release-order questions.

If a sentence has already moved the person into the Texas prison system, switch to the TDCJ offender search. If a federal or immigration hold is involved, Waller may be able to identify the hold, but BOP, U.S. Marshals, or ICE channels may also be needed.

Waller County Jail Booking Path

Trinity County booking can begin locally and continue through off-site placement. Intake usually includes identity confirmation, search, property inventory, fingerprints, booking photo if taken, charge entry, medical and mental-health screening, classification, phone access, first appearance, and bond or hold decision. When housing is assigned, a Trinity County inmate may be moved to Waller County Jail.

The transfer changes where the person sleeps, visits, and receives mail. It does not automatically change the court that handles the case. Current-custody records belong with the jail holding the inmate, while Trinity court records and charge status can remain with Trinity County. Waller County Jail Court Bond

For a Trinity case, bond questions should be checked with Trinity County even if Waller County Jail confirms physical custody. A bond can be cash, surety, personal bond, or blocked by a no-bond hold. A detainer from another agency can also affect release. Waller can report custody status, but the case county or court may control the release order.

Surety bond
A bond posted through a licensed bondsman or agent rather than full cash paid by the family.
No-bond hold
A custody status that does not allow release by posting a standard bond at that time.
Case county
The county where the charge, warrant, court setting, or prosecutor action is pending.
